VanMan,
The engines are very similar.  They are both DOHC and both have identical-looking plug modules in the same place, the centre of the cam cover between the cams.  The cover for the 16V shows as DOHC2000 16V - not sure about the 8v.

The simple way is to check the vin plate: the 8V would be shown as engine code NSD and the 16V is shown as N3A.  If you think that the engine has been swopped (this is a lot of work because the EECV and everything connected would have to be changed as well) then you could look up from underneath on the engine on the engine block on the offside - the engine code is stamped on the side of the block.

I dont think the 8valve has the VIS,variable intake system. If its a 16valve then it will be clearly marked (VIS) on the intake plenum behind the throttle body.
